I say Matt Morgan, he signed a five year contract 3 years ago, and every report I have seen says his contract expired. Something doesn't quite seem right about a 5 year deal expiring in 3 years...
Actually, that's quite common. You sign a long-term deal but leave the last year or two open to re-negotiation. Basically what that means is that when the time comes both sides sit down, try to evaluate where they stand and work out new terms and if they can't they go their separate ways. Essentially the last two years of the contract are optionable and if they can't work out new terms the contract doesn't roll over and is terminated. There was a similar situation with Kurt Angle a couple of years ago but obviously he chose to stay in TNA, his optionable year rolled over and then he signed a new deal last year.

Just to be clear, I'm not saying Morgan isn't involved in this. He may be. Anything's possible. I'm simply explaining why he could be gone from TNA even though he signed a 5-year deal back in 2009.
